"A Trip to Scarborough", a satiric comedy by Richard Brinsley Sheridan, the eighteenth century playwright, which will be the only performance in Boston by the Jitney Players, Incorporated, will be presented in the ballroom of the Hotel Statler on January 18.
The Jitney Players have toured the country during the last six summers with a stage constructed on their truck, giving performances at various summer resorts.
The Sheridan comedy will be presented exactly as it was on February 24, 1777, at the opening of the Drury Lane Theatre in London.
